REIGNING CHAMPION AMY SCHNEIDER RETURNED TO

JEOPARDY!’ TODAY, NOTCHED 14th VICTORY

 

Schneider’s $34,800 Win Brings Total Prize Money To $571,200

 

CULVER CITY, CALIF. (December 20, 2021) – After a two-week break for the first-ever Professors Tournament, reigning champion Amy Schneider returned to JEOPARDY! today and notched her 14th straight victory. The engineering manager from Oakland, Calif.’s winnings now total $571,200, which puts her in fourth place on the all-time highest non-tournament earnings list. Only three contestants have won more money than her: Matt Amodio ($1,518,601), James Holzhauer ($2,462,216) and Ken Jennings ($2,520,700).

 

I’ve been watching the show since I was a kid,” Schneider said of her place among the top players in JEOPARDY! history. “I’ve watched all the people on this list, and to see my name up with them is a very good feeling.”

 

Through her first 14 games, Schneider responded correctly to all but one Final Jeopardy! clue, a level of accuracy that only Holzhauer had previously achieved.

 

I definitely feel lucky about it, and there’s an extent to which you just get ones that you know,” said Schneider. “But, once or twice, I also felt pretty good about my deduction [skills].”

JEOPARDY!, America’s Favorite Quiz Show™, is in its 38th season in syndication. With a weekly audience over 20 million viewers,* JEOPARDY! is the top-rated quiz show on television. The show has won a total of 42 Emmy® Awards, holds the Guinness World Records® title for the most Emmy® Awards won by a TV game show, and received a Peabody Award for “celebrating and rewarding knowledge.” JEOPARDY! is produced by Sony Pictures Television, a Sony Pictures Entertainment Company; it is distributed domestically by CBS Media Ventures and internationally by ViacomCBS Global Distribution Group, both units of ViacomCBS.
